Is a 125cc dirt bike big enough?

A 125cc four stroke dirt bike can be a great bike for taller kids and smaller and lighter weight adults as the bike offers a decent seating position without having too much power. Before you throw a leg over any dirt bike, no matter the size you should get in the habit of wearing the proper protective gear.11 mar 2015

What's a good size dirt bike for a 17 year old?

What Size Dirt Bike for a 15 to 17-Year-Old. A 150cc dirt bike is still a good option, but if your teen is larger and more experienced, they could very well use a 200cc or even a 250cc dirt bike, which is already a full-sized adult bike.

What is a good size dirt bike for a teenager?

It is recommended that only teenagers from the age of 16-years upward consider riding a 250cc dirt bike. Even so, you should only consider this bike for your kid if they are tall for their age and have the experience and strength to be able to tame a 250cc dirt bike.11 may 2021

How tall should you be to ride a 250 dirt bike?

There is no specific height requirement for a person to ride a 250f dirt bike. The best way to know if you are fit for a 250f Dirt Bike is to sit on it where both of your feet, specifically the forefoot, can touch the ground.

How old do you have to be to ride a 150cc dirt bike?

The age groups for competitive riding are as follows: 4 to 6-year-olds would start with a 50cc Yamaha PW (often called a PeeWee) bike or similar. By around 8 years old they can ride a 65/80cc mini motocross machine. At age 10 or 11, kids can ride anything up to a 150cc 4 stroke, or 65/80cc two strokes.

What dirt bike is good for a 12 year old?

For a 10 11 or 12-year-old average kid that wants to learn to ride dirt bikes and he or she is not too much into racing or a serious motocross I would recommend Honda CRF110F, which is the bike that my nephew rides, following by the Kawasaki KLX110, or the Yamaha TT-R110E model.

What age is a 125cc dirt bike for?

Child Age Child Height Engine Size In CC ------------- ---------------------------- ----------------- 3 – 7-years 2ft 7-inches To 3ft 7-inches 50cc 7 – 12-years 3ft 7-inches To 4ft 7-inches 50cc – 110cc 12 – 14-years 5ft To 5ft 2-inches 125cc 14 – 16-years 5ft 2-inches To 5ft 8-inches 125cc – 250cc

Is a 125cc dirt bike good for beginners?

Is a 125cc dirt bike good for beginners? It depends on what kind of 125cc dirt bike you're considering. A 125 two-stroke is not good for beginners, but a 125 four-stroke is a great trail bike if you're new to riding.6 dic 2021
